This study aims to determine the implementation of character education in fifth grade students at SDN Wanoja 02 Brebes Regency, Central Java. This study aims to describe and analyze the implementation of character education in class V students at SDN Wanoja 02. Based on the research results, it was found that the implementation of character education in class V students at SDN Wanoja 02 in learning activities and outside learning activities is carried out in various ways. The implementation of character education in learning is implemented through five models, namely habituation, learning methods, conditioning, exemplary, and providing motivation, advice, understanding, and appreciation. Meanwhile, the implementation of character education outside of learning activities is implemented through habituation, provision of school programs, exemplary, and provision of motivation and appreciation.

This research is an experimental research with pre-experiment method, this research design is the one group pretest posttest. This study aims to determine the effectiveness of the Student Team Achievement Division (STAD) learning model in identifying information and summarizing explanatory text. The samples in this study were VIII grade students. Based on the results of research and data analysis regarding the comparison of statistical values, the comparison of learning outcomes categories and the comparison of the level of completeness proves that the improvement of student learning outcomes can be seen from the data on student learning outcomes through descriptive statistical analysis before using the Student Team Achievement Division (STAD) learning model, the average student score is still below the KKM value, namely 49.57 and after using the Student Team Achievement Division (STAD) learning model, the average student score increases above the KKM, namely 84.21. It is known that the posttest value is 84.21 more than the Pretest value which is 49.57. Furthermore, based on the results of inferential statistical analysis using the t-test formula, it is known that the t_ (count) obtained is 4.371 with the frequency df = 14 -1 = 13, at a significant level of 0.05 or 5% the t_table is 1.770. So t_ (count) > t_table or H_0 rejected H_1 accepted. These results can be concluded that there is a significant increase in student learning outcomes. This means that the use of the Student Teams Achievement Division (STAD) learning model is effective in learning to identify information and summarize explanatory texts in class VIII students of SMP Muhammadiyah 10 Makassar.

The Toba Batak tribe has a distinctive fabric known as ulos. Toba Batak ulos have types depending on their uses. But in the modern era, especially among urban communities, very few people know the types and uses. Motivated by the success of Convolutional Neural Network (CNN) algorithm in image classification, this study will conduct a learning-based approach to classify 5 types of Toba Batak ulos (Ragi Hidup, Ragi Hotang, Mangiring, Sadum, and Sibolang). The process starts from data collection, data analysis, model building, model training, and confusion matrix. The dataset used is 1000 images with 80% training data, 10% valid data, and 10% test data. Convolution, maxpooling, dropout, flatten, and fully connected are the 5 layers forming the CNN model. The optimizer used is Adam with a learning rate of 0.001. The model generated in this study can detect Toba Batak ulos images at an accuracy rate of 94.00%.
